Help Creating a Book:
You can create 8" x 8" and 8" x 11" photo books that feature your own captions, titles, and photos printed directly on the book's cover.

To create a custom cover, begin by creating an 8" x 8" or 8" x 11" Custom Cover Photo Book, then follow the steps below.

1. On the "create your photo book" page, you'll see your book template at the center of the page, your collected photos at the right, and a scroll bar of menu options below your template. To design your custom cover, click on the "covers" tab, and then on the cover style you'd like.


2. Your custom cover will appear as the main image on the page. To add photos to your cover, drag and drop photos from your collected photos in the areas labeled "drag photo here." (Only one photo fits in each photo area.) To remove a photo from your cover, click the "X" that appears when you mouse over the photo.

Tip: You can edit a photo after you've placed it on your cover by clicking on the paintbrush icon that appears at the center of the photo. Once you're happy with your edits, click "apply changes." This will only edit the photo on your cover, not the master copy of the photo in your library.


3. To add captions or titles to your cover, click on an area labeled "click to edit." A small pop-up window will appear with a field for you to type in your message. You can change the font, text size, text color, and alignment by using the icons at the top of the window. Once you're happy with your captions, click the "apply changes" button.


4. If you want to change cover styles, click on a new design in the "covers" tab. Your photos and captions won't be affected unless the new style has a different layout.


5. Once you're happy with your custom cover, you can continue editing and designing your photo book, preview your book and check out, or save your progress to finish your photo book later. You'll be able to review your cover and photo book again before checkout by clicking on the "preview book" button."
